New digital wax pot from Yates & Bird Motloid Company helps you make perfect copings every time.

Digital temperature display is accurate to within 1° C, within a temperature range of 50° - 115° C. A hand °C to °F conversion guide is included. Two easy-to-use buttons raise and lower the temperature and allow the machine to quickly reach and maintain the desired heat.

The pot is small and portable: 4.5"x4.75"x2". A switchable AC adaptor is included, making one machine functional for both 110v and 220v needs.

While the Digital Wax Pot is compatible with most coping techniques and most dipping waxes, it is especially designed to be used with Yates & Bird Green Dipping Wax, in quick-melting pellets.
